diff options
author | Martin Polden <mpolden@mpolden.no> | 2020-06-25 09:09:52 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-06-25 09:09:52 +0200 |
commit | a979e89b4c4f96c2ddcbd03509b84cb6e0d6812c (patch) | |
tree | 74ab0e77275ee9278554f519517620a16df278b6 /node-repository/src/main | |
parent | 1b7958527aa2cc2289f556b8b1dde954a9b581f8 (diff) | |
parent | f4ca256a00d397de7edba60246634b00b7f9830d (diff) |
Merge pull request #13682 from vespa-engine/mpolden/remove-flag
Remove configserver-provision-lb flag
Diffstat (limited to 'node-repository/src/main')
-rw-r--r-- | node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/LoadBalancerProvisioner.java | 5 |
1 files changed, 1 insertions, 4 deletions
diff --git a/node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/LoadBalancerProvisioner.java b/node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/LoadBalancerProvisioner.java index bb25e8371a2..e710d70f20f 100644 --- a/node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/LoadBalancerProvisioner.java +++ b/node-repository/src/main/java/com/yahoo/vespa/hosted/provision/provisioning/LoadBalancerProvisioner.java @@ -50,14 +50,12 @@ public class LoadBalancerProvisioner { private final NodeRepository nodeRepository; private final CuratorDatabaseClient db; private final LoadBalancerService service; - private final BooleanFlag provisionConfigServerLoadBalancer; private final BooleanFlag provisionControllerLoadBalancer; public LoadBalancerProvisioner(NodeRepository nodeRepository, LoadBalancerService service, FlagSource flagSource) { this.nodeRepository = nodeRepository; this.db = nodeRepository.database(); this.service = service; - this.provisionConfigServerLoadBalancer = Flags.CONFIGSERVER_PROVISION_LB.bindTo(flagSource); this.provisionControllerLoadBalancer = Flags.CONTROLLER_PROVISION_LB.bindTo(flagSource); // Read and write all load balancers to make sure they are stored in the latest version of the serialization format for (var id : db.readLoadBalancerIds()) { @@ -149,11 +147,10 @@ public class LoadBalancerProvisioner { db.writeLoadBalancers(deactivatedLoadBalancers, transaction); } - // TODO(mpolden): Inline when feature flags are removed + // TODO(mpolden): Inline when feature flag is removed private boolean canForwardTo(NodeType type, ClusterSpec cluster) { boolean canForwardTo = service.canForwardTo(type, cluster.type()); if (canForwardTo) { - if (type == NodeType.config) return provisionConfigServerLoadBalancer.value(); if (type == NodeType.controller) return provisionControllerLoadBalancer.value(); } return canForwardTo; |